Belagavi Woman Assaulted and Paraded Naked: Minister Assures Strict Action

Belagavi: In a shocking incident, a woman was allegedly assaulted, paraded naked, and tied to an electric pole in Belagavi district. The assault occurred after her son eloped with a woman who was supposed to get engaged to someone else. Karnataka Home Minister G Parameshwara has assured the assembly that strict action will be taken against the culprits.

The incident took place in New Vantamuri village, where the woman’s family, about 20 members, damaged the house of her son, who had eloped with a 20-year-old woman. The 55-year-old mother of the eloping man was dragged outside, paraded naked, and tied to an electricity pole by the family members of the woman. Twelve accused have been arrested, including the woman’s father, mother, brothers, and uncles, in connection with the incident. Karnataka Home Minister G Parameshwara visited the victim at the hospital and the village, expressing outrage over the incident. The eloping couple, a 24-year-old man and a 20-year-old woman, had been in a relationship for nearly two years. The woman’s family arranged her marriage to another man, prompting the couple to run away. Efforts are underway to find the young couple to ensure their safety and prevent any extreme steps in response to the incident.

Parameshwara emphasized the need for societal change, stating that incidents like these are shameful for society. He assured protection for the young couple and their families, condemning the assault on the woman.

District in-charge minister Satish Jarkiholi and women and child development minister Lakshmi Hebbalkar visited the victim at the hospital, instructing hospital authorities to limit visits to family members for her rest and recovery.

The incident has sparked discussions about the safety of women and the fear of law and police in the state. The Home Minister pledged that the government would take stringent action against the accused and work towards preventing such incidents in the future.
